QuinceNetwork is a marketplace where families plan their quinceañera and vendors run their businesses. These guidelines keep it that way.
What we expect
- Transparent pricing.Vendors list real, non-negotiable prices. No “DM for pricing” gatekeeping.
- Respect for the tradition. Correct vocabulary — quinceañera, chambelán, dama, vals, padrinos — spelled correctly, used correctly.
- Honest reviews. Reviews come only from families with signed booking contracts. No third-party reviews. No gang-up campaigns.
- Direct, professional communication. Families and vendors message on-platform; we keep a record so disputes resolve fairly.
What's not allowed
- Harassment, hate speech, or targeted abuse of any person or group.
- False claims — fake portfolio work, fake reviews, fake credentials.
- Off-platform payment requests or attempts to bypass platform fees.
- Sexually explicit content. This is a family platform.
- Spam, repeated promotional posts, or coordinated inauthentic behavior.
- Content featuring minors in exploitative contexts.
- Intellectual property violations — don't post photos or designs that aren't yours to share.
How we enforce
Every report is reviewed within 48 hours. Actions range from a private warning, to post removal, to a 7-day suspension, to a permanent ban — proportional to the violation.
We maintain a full audit trail. Every admin action is logged with reason, reviewer, and timestamp. Any user can request a review of enforcement against them.
Reporting something
Use the report form for vendor-related issues. Every post has a “Report” option in its menu. Every profile has a block option. We take every report seriously, and we never share reporter identity with the reported party.
